Norihiko Kawamura (河村 典彦, Kawamura Norihiko, October 14, 1964) is a Japanese Renju player. He won Renju World Champion in 1995.[1] Up to 2004, Kawamura has been the Japan's Meijin title holder for 3 years.[2]
